About this school
St Paul's Catholic Primary School, A Voluntary Academy is a academy converter serving families in Stockport and the wider Cheshire East area. The school is well established within the local education landscape.
The school educates mixed pupils aged 4 to 11. It currently has 105 pupils on roll with space for 150, offering a broad curriculum across all primary year groups.
Ofsted last inspected the school on 30 April 2024, awarding it a Outstanding rating. The report noted positive aspects of leadership, safeguarding and the school’s approach to pupil development.
